Excel Google Maps API: Distance and Travel Time Calculator with Directions API (JSON e XML)

Поділитися
Вставка
  • Опубліковано 16 вер 2024

КОМЕНТАРІ • 107

  • @DevNascimento
    @DevNascimento  3 місяці тому

    🔴LIVE 03 - Domine o uso de APIs do Google Maps no Excel
    Link: ua-cam.com/users/liveu0g1BdzxfGA?feature=share

  • @ThiagoPadovanni
    @ThiagoPadovanni 2 місяці тому

    PARABÉNS!!! Melhor solução para traçar rotas. Forma simples, eficiente e prática

  • @termuxparadev
    @termuxparadev 3 роки тому +4

    Funcionalidade muito importante principalmente para planejamento logístico. Obrigado.

  • @ANCCosta
    @ANCCosta 5 місяців тому

    Parabéns, man! Vídeo excelente, o mais simples que encontrei, me ajudou muito!

  • @gutooliveira7236
    @gutooliveira7236 4 місяці тому

    Parabéns pelo vídeo. Estou adaptando para o Bing Maps. Valeu!

  • @walterleydepicolisouza6642
    @walterleydepicolisouza6642 24 дні тому

    show!!!

  • @heraldocandidodacruz4587
    @heraldocandidodacruz4587 Рік тому

    Parabéns pelo vídeo, muito bem explicado e me ajudou muito em um projeto que estou fazendo. Continue assim, ganhou um inscrito e um like. Abraços.

  • @Dionatan02100
    @Dionatan02100 2 роки тому +1

    Showw muito bom, me ajudou muito. Obrigado pelo vídeo.

  • @AlexandreCruz
    @AlexandreCruz Рік тому +1

    Valeu!

  • @ericvieira87
    @ericvieira87 2 роки тому +2

    Excelente vídeo. O problema do CEP com inicial zero foi resolvido! Uma dúvida sobre o faturamento do Google, se passar dos 1000 usos é cobrado do cartão?

  • @julio_freitas124
    @julio_freitas124 2 роки тому +1

    Parabéns pelo vídeo! Mais uns inscrito guerreiro!!

  • @Teamsonic6473
    @Teamsonic6473 3 роки тому

    muito bom o video, excelente conteudo.
    Ansioso para o projeto profissional com essa api

  • @sarepresentacoes10
    @sarepresentacoes10 Рік тому +2

    Excelente explicação, mas como poderemos resolver o problema de a função =SERVIÇOWEB( ), permiti apenas xml até 32.767 caracteres, pois acima disso dá o erro #VALOR!

  • @moisesaraujo8719
    @moisesaraujo8719 2 роки тому

    Boa noite!
    Excelente conteúdo...

    • @moisesaraujo8719
      @moisesaraujo8719 2 роки тому

      surgiu esse erro:
      {
      "error_message" : "This API project is not authorized to use this API.",
      "routes" : [],
      "status" : "REQUEST_DENIED"
      }
      Sabe me dizer o que pode resover?

  • @daviferreira9297
    @daviferreira9297 2 роки тому +2

    quando uso a "serviçoweb" a planilha retorna #Valor! como resolver?

  • @marciofagundes5568
    @marciofagundes5568 Рік тому +1

    Não sei se está faltando algo, mas ao tentar a formula =serviçoweb, não consigo ober o resultado igual ao vídeo

  • @analuisapimentel783
    @analuisapimentel783 2 роки тому

    Muito bom o video, parabéns!!

  • @user-di8gn5ht9c
    @user-di8gn5ht9c 4 місяці тому

    Excelente vídeo. Por favor, tenho uma dúvida. Como faço para trazer o separador da coordenada?
    Exemplos: A URL na start_location da latitude: -1.4563433, porém no excel vem sem o separador -14563433.
    A URL na end_location da latitude: -0.6237904, porém no excel apresentou -0.6237904.

  • @julianasoares5268
    @julianasoares5268 Рік тому

    Ótimo vídeo, não entendo nada de programação e consegui pôr em prática. Agora, é possível levar essa programação, pra dentro de um layout já existente?

  • @marcosm9192
    @marcosm9192 2 роки тому

    Ajudou demais amigo

  • @ratao3000
    @ratao3000 Рік тому

    ótimo vídeo... vc fez algum vídeo explicando como buscar por coordenadas?

  • @pedrofffranco
    @pedrofffranco Рік тому +2

    Obrigado pelo video !
    Eu fiz exatamente igual você , mas como o nome do nome pode influenciar no deputação do da função serviçosweb , pois algumas cidades a formula dava #valor , Quando tentava cidade com nome simple Ex : divinopolis mg , Formiga mg dava certo , mas belo horizonte e juiz de fora não .

    • @DevNascimento
      @DevNascimento  Рік тому +1

      Isso é uma limitação do uso da função, não tem nada a ver com sintaxe dos nomes. Está relacionado com distâncias superiores a 300km. Esse mesmo problema não ocorre quando você usa VBA

    • @pedrofffranco
      @pedrofffranco Рік тому

      @@DevNascimento Compreendo ! Então terei que procura como criar Api Google maps VBA , correto ?

    • @DevNascimento
      @DevNascimento  Рік тому +1

      @@pedrofffranco Isso, ou você pode adquirir meu curso hahaha. Mas é isso mesmo Pedro, procura como parsear XML via API

    • @pedrofffranco
      @pedrofffranco Рік тому

      ​@@DevNascimentome enviar o link , por favor , terei esse conteúdo?

    • @DevNascimento
      @DevNascimento  Рік тому

      @@pedrofffranco Link de que? do Curso?

  • @akuna9119
    @akuna9119 2 роки тому

    interessante leagal

  • @fernandoedelsondasilva-jca2528
    @fernandoedelsondasilva-jca2528 3 роки тому +1

    amigo, sensacional o seu vídeo. só me ajuda em uma coisa... para a distância a pé, como seria a alteração?

    • @DevNascimento
      @DevNascimento  3 роки тому +1

      Olá Fernando, não precisa alterar nada, você vai apenas inserir o parâmetro "&mode=bicycling" antes da chave API, para ser mais exato, antes do "&Key=". Qualquer dúvida, estarei a disposição!!

    • @fernandoedelson
      @fernandoedelson 3 роки тому

      @@DevNascimento vou testar aqui. Parabéns amigo!

  • @Agente_patologic
    @Agente_patologic 7 місяців тому

    Video bem explicado e excelente. Obrigado pela ajuda. Não sei se eu errei no processo, mas quando tento calcular um endereço de KM baixo, consigo obter o resultado (ex: dentro da mesma cidade), agora, ss tento ver a distância entre estados, o Excel nao traz.

    • @DevNascimento
      @DevNascimento  7 місяців тому

      Esse é uma limitação do uso com fórmulas, o mesmo não ocorre quando se usa o VBA

    • @Agente_patologic
      @Agente_patologic 7 місяців тому

      @@DevNascimento obrigado, você tem o vídeo da solução em VBA?

  • @rafaelloureiro9930
    @rafaelloureiro9930 11 місяців тому

    Eu tenho que ter as coordenadas ou posso colocar diretamente os endereços?

  • @Leo-kq5uz
    @Leo-kq5uz Рік тому

    Olá, esse serviço é gratuito? tem como fazer um mapa desse com o valor de um ponto para outro?
    Obrigado.

  • @IgorOliveira-yo1ht
    @IgorOliveira-yo1ht 3 роки тому +1

    Meu amigo, na parte de "CRIAR CREDENCIAIS" você não demonstrou e a chave que gerei não está dando certo... Consegue detalhar o que fazer depois de clicar nesse botão?

    • @DevNascimento
      @DevNascimento  3 роки тому

      Oi Igor, já tive esse mesmo problema. Crie uma nova chave e tente novamente. Fique atendo a URL, ela deve ser montada corretamente. Com relação a criação de chaves API, no UA-cam existem vídeos ensinando como criar

  • @thamiresbrito7891
    @thamiresbrito7891 2 роки тому +1

    boa queria saber tenho um site. de transporte queria saber se com essa ferramenta eu consigo cria uma pagina quando o cliente entra ele pode calcular o valor do frete , sabendo ja a distancia do seu trajeto e valor do frete é possivel .

    • @DevNascimento
      @DevNascimento  2 роки тому

      Boa tarde Thamires, para esse tipo de situação, existem soluções já prontas para serem usadas em sites. Pesquise por "plugin dos correios" no navegador, você encontrará vídeos ensinando como usar. Ou, se desejar trabalhar com uma API diretamente, pesquise "API correios".

  • @ricardo200x
    @ricardo200x 2 роки тому

    Valeu pelas dicas. Tem alguma forma de definir a prioridade do caminho, por exemplo, otimizar percurso ou evitar pedágio?

    • @DevNascimento
      @DevNascimento  2 роки тому +1

      Existe sim Ricardo, porém, usando código. Usando apenas funções conforme mostrei no vídeo, os recursos são bem limitados!

    • @ricardo200x
      @ricardo200x 2 роки тому

      @@DevNascimento Valeu.

  • @leonardonascimento8613
    @leonardonascimento8613 8 місяців тому

    Não consegui acessar a minha chave API

  • @rafaelmendes829
    @rafaelmendes829 5 місяців тому

    Bom dia
    Tentando fazer 2024 a pagina do chrome mudou e nao a cho o link de acesso para colocar minha chave API

    • @DevNascimento
      @DevNascimento  4 місяці тому

      Oi Rafael, vou fazer um vídeo atualizado

  • @filipesilva8852
    @filipesilva8852 2 роки тому

    Alguem consegue me ajudar?
    Achei muito ultiu o video, mais no meu caso, no lugar de colocar o endereço, preciso colocar a Latitude e longitude, seria possivel?

  • @mariocruzz
    @mariocruzz Рік тому +1

    A fórmula webservice não funciona no meu excel. O que eu posso fazer?

  • @eduardomelo7079
    @eduardomelo7079 3 роки тому

    shooooooooooooooooooow

  • @Edson.geoiuris
    @Edson.geoiuris 2 роки тому +1

    Esta aula me possibilitou resolver um problema do tamanho de Minas Gerais. Porém, o Google Maps não me ajuda, pois NÃO está me retornando a MENOR distância entre os pontos. Preciso da distância menor e não do trajeto mais rápido. Alguém pode me auxiliar?

  • @Wigor2
    @Wigor2 3 місяці тому

    Olá, estou estudando e procurando uma solução. Eu tenho um rota em que o veiculo precisa percorrer e tirar o horário de almoço, estou tentando fazer uma preposição: rota= quantidade de km e cidades; por horas rodadas vai da parada em qual cidade, onde o mínimo rodado é 600km dia. Você já viu algo parecido?

    • @DevNascimento
      @DevNascimento  3 місяці тому +1

      Oi Igor, fique de olho no canal essa semana, irei fazer alguns lançamentos relacionados a otimização de rotas bem interessantes

    • @Wigor2
      @Wigor2 3 місяці тому

      @@DevNascimento opa, vou ficar de olho sim

  • @gutocaiio
    @gutocaiio 2 роки тому

    Função TOP! Gostaria de saber como deixou alinhado no excel, pois quando o meu retorna o valor na função WebService ele fica em uma linha apenas

    • @gutocaiio
      @gutocaiio 2 роки тому +1

      Aqui passou de 200km ele retorna como #VALOR!

  •  2 роки тому +1

    Amigo, quando a origem é de uma UF diferente da do destino, apresenta erro. Será que tem algo errado?

    • @DevNascimento
      @DevNascimento  2 роки тому +1

      Fala Júnior, essa é uma limitação do uso com as funções do Excel. O menso erro não ocorre quando vc usa VBA

  • @nilsonsantos7375
    @nilsonsantos7375 2 роки тому

    rapaiz, to tentando dar um control+c + control+v do seu video, porém quando eu escrevo o código = Q3& "origin=" & Q4 & "&destination=" & Q5 & "&key=" & Q6 ele fica com o resultado " 0 " e não aparece igual o seu com o link do googlemaps .... o que pode ser isso? já alterei o tipo de texto, para todos tipos possiveis, e ele continua aparecendo 0 , e o código está identico ao seu :(
    Poderia me ajudaaaar?
    Vc é muito bom, nisso, que Deus lhe abençoe viu, muito bom seus videos.

  • @Mariuzicleide
    @Mariuzicleide Рік тому

    Minha formula serviçoweb também retorna com valor #VALOR!, ja fucei tudo e não acho o erro

  • @TheGuanaz
    @TheGuanaz 11 місяців тому

    olá, como posso usar o filtroxml para extrair uma tag que contem mesmo nome? pois eu usei a API Geocoding, ali contem informações especificas mas os nomes das tgs sao iguais para "result"

    • @TheGuanaz
      @TheGuanaz 11 місяців тому +1

      ops consegui kkkkk usei a função Índice dessa forma e trouxe as demais tags com mesmo nome:
      =ÍNDICE(FILTROXML(M11;"GeocodeResponse/result/address_component/short_name");2)
      =ÍNDICE(FILTROXML(M11;"GeocodeResponse/result/address_component/short_name");3)
      ☺☺

    • @DevNascimento
      @DevNascimento  11 місяців тому

      Opa, você também pode usar da seguinte forma👇:
      .../row/element[1]/distance/value
      .../row/element[2]/distance/value

  • @igormacedo2995
    @igormacedo2995 Рік тому

    onde vc cria isso do inicio?

  • @dndaniel
    @dndaniel 2 роки тому +1

    Como faço pra converter o

    • @DevNascimento
      @DevNascimento  2 роки тому

      Opa Daniel, blz? Então, você pode usar uma máscara

    • @dndaniel
      @dndaniel 2 роки тому +1

      @@DevNascimento Eu consegui, fiz pelo value e acrescentei uma célula com o cálculo convertendo para horas, porém tem que usar em minutos que é o valor que retorna e depois converter para o cálculo, muito obrigado.

    • @DevNascimento
      @DevNascimento  2 роки тому +1

      @@dndaniel Beleza! Outra coisa que eu acabei só percebendo depois que fiz o vídeo, são as coordenadas. Quando vc joga para a dentro da célula, ele acaba apagando o "ponto", isso devido ao fato de a célula estar formatado em número geral, e mesmo que você, e se vc converter a célula para texto, não vai funcionar pq nesse formato não se consegue escrever funções. No final das contas, daria para trazer esses dados corretamente usando vba.

    • @dndaniel
      @dndaniel 2 роки тому +1

      @@DevNascimento acabei não usando vordenadas e fiz alguns ajustes, para em um formulário, preencher qualquer local e ele funcionou como se pesquisasse no Google maps, só queria que ele retornasse o tempo do trajeto baseado no trânsito em tempo real, mas não tive tempo de testar algo para isso, abs e seu canal é muito top, parabéns

    • @DevNascimento
      @DevNascimento  2 роки тому

      @@dndaniel Obrigado Daniel, qualquer coisa, estamos por aqui! Abraço!!

  • @marciofagundes5568
    @marciofagundes5568 Рік тому

    Não estou conseguindo usar a formula =webserviço() ao chamar esta dando um erro "xml version="1.0" ecoding="UTF-8"?>REQUEST_DENIEDYou must an API key authenticate each request to Google Maps Plataforma APIs

  • @mogi894
    @mogi894 3 роки тому

    Cara, seu video é maravilhoso, me ajudou muito.
    Só um ponto, poderia fazer um exemplo com São Paulo e rio de Janeiro, estou tentando e a formula SERVIÇOWEB da #VALOR

    • @DevNascimento
      @DevNascimento  3 роки тому

      Olá Felipe, verifique se a URL está correta, escreva o endereço completo (ex: São Paulo, SP, Brasil)

    • @Edson.geoiuris
      @Edson.geoiuris 2 роки тому +1

      @@DevNascimento não sei se é o caso, mas todas as consultas que faço por este método só retornam sem a #VALOR se a distância entre os 2 pontos for, em média, MENOR QUE 200 KM.
      Acima deste valor sempre resulta a # VALOR.

    • @DevNascimento
      @DevNascimento  2 роки тому +1

      @@Edson.geoiuris você tentou outros endereços?

    • @Edson.geoiuris
      @Edson.geoiuris 2 роки тому +1

      @@DevNascimento fiz vários testes. Distância curtas, < 200 km, retornam os resultados DISTÂNCIA e TEMPO exatamente como nos ensinou, mas as distâncias > 200 km resultam #VALOR.

    • @DevNascimento
      @DevNascimento  2 роки тому +1

      @@Edson.geoiuris Vou verificar aqui, mas até os pontos que usei no vídeo tem mais de 200km de distância. Você não adicionou nenhuma condição extra dentro da URL?

  • @diegoantonio59
    @diegoantonio59 3 роки тому

    Quando da erro, exemplo, todo o caminho está correto no Excel, mas quando vai buscar a referencia, ele não trás a distancia e nem o tempo, O endereço está conforme no google maps:
    Origem: Parque Industrial de Betim
    Destino: Distrito Industrial, Juiz de Fora - MG
    Tempo: #VALOR
    Distancia: #VALOR
    O que deve ser feito?

    • @DevNascimento
      @DevNascimento  3 роки тому +1

      Lembre-se que você está solicitando a localização de um endereço para um robô, portanto, procure sempre colocar o endereço completo. Exemplo: "Parque industrial de betim, Betim, MG, Brasil"

    • @diegoantonio59
      @diegoantonio59 3 роки тому

      @@DevNascimento Man, coloquei conforme indicação, o erro permanece, vc daria algum tipo de consultoria?

    • @DevNascimento
      @DevNascimento  3 роки тому

      Sim, me mande seu WhatsApp por e-mail: dosilvamarcelo@gmail.com

  • @jonasuea
    @jonasuea 2 роки тому

    You must use an API key to authenticate each request to Google Maps Platform APIs.

    • @DevNascimento
      @DevNascimento  2 роки тому

      😳 sem criar uma chave válida não vai mesmo. Tens que criar uma credencial

  • @Renansilvamoura
    @Renansilvamoura 3 місяці тому

    Como consigo aprender isso?

    • @DevNascimento
      @DevNascimento  3 місяці тому

      Oi Renan, vai rolar uma live, fixei o link aqui nos comentários

    • @Renansilvamoura
      @Renansilvamoura 3 місяці тому

      @@DevNascimento tô com um problema no trabalho para resolver consegue me ensinar antes? Qual seu contato?

    • @DevNascimento
      @DevNascimento  3 місяці тому

      @@Renansilvamoura Aqui no perfil do canal tem um link para meu WhatsApp

  • @robsonbernal_robyinfo
    @robsonbernal_robyinfo Рік тому

    CRIEI NOVA CHAVE MAS... O ERRO PERCISTE